What’s The Buzz Around GLP-1?

You’ve probably seen “GLP-1” thrown around in health circles. GLP-1 stands for glucagon-like peptide-1, a hormone that helps regulate blood sugar levels, curb your appetite, and slow down digestion. That combo? It’s like putting your cravings on mute.

Pharmaceuticals like Ozempic and Wegovy work by mimicking GLP-1, which is why they’ve exploded in popularity. Piguiay claims to trigger this same pathway — naturally.

So, no needles. Just drops.

Is Piguiay Backed by Science?

Here’s where it gets a bit murky.

Moringa has a decent amount of research supporting its ant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, and blood sugar regulation effects. However, the connection to GLP-1 stimulation is still being explored in the natural health world.

So, while there’s some science behind the ingredients, we can’t say Piguiay’s exact formula has gone through clinical trials. Always good to keep your expectations grounded.

Side Effects: Should You Be Worried?

The brand claims it’s made with 100% natural ingredients and has no side effects. That said, here are a few things to keep in mind:

  • Moringa might lower blood sugar — be cautious if you’re on diabetes meds.
  • Some users report digestive changes (like mild diarrhea or bloating).
  • Taste? Some say it’s earthy, others say it’s bitter.

When in doubt, always check with your healthcare provider.
